Output e573260ec510650529971ace66944acd34dff4adae75a0a5d7bfcce111689b31:5
- value
- 12430889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 823d90aeac83936e82fcce2a89c755c332409028 OP_EQUAL
- address
- MKmopzRNZwXKdRpf71drif87WsW3rFkfPv
- transaction
- e573260ec510650529971ace66944acd34dff4adae75a0a5d7bfcce111689b31
- spent
- true